Vous ne trouvez pas de réponse à votre problème ? Alors posez la question dans le forum. Souvenez-vous qu'il n'y a jamais de question bête, mais rester dans l'ignorance parce que l'on n'ose pas poser une question, ça c'est une erreur !

Sujet : Lire un fichier son au chargement d'une form [ Archives / Multimédia ] (Tupac59)

mardi 7 mars 2006 à 20:36:40 | Lire un fichier son au chargement d'une form

Tupac59

Bonjour, dans le cadre d'une PTI je dois développer une application en évenementiel. J'essai de créer un petit jeu pour enfants sur les tables de multiplications. Pour le rendre plus atrayant je voudrais intégrer des petits sons.

Comment lire un fichier son dans une form sans que ca ouvre un lecteur (winamp...), je voudrais juste que l'on atende le son dans la form.

si vous pouviez me mettre un petit exemple

D'avance merci

mardi 7 mars 2006 à 21:11:54 | Re : Lire un fichier son au chargement d'une form

MorpionMx

Membre Club Administrateur CodeS-SourceS
Salut

Tu travailles en .Net 1 ou .Net 2 ?
En .Net1, tu dois passer par une API (regarde ici)
En .Net2, il y a la classe System.Media.SoundPlayer

Sinon, il te reste la possibilité d'utiliser DirectX, et AudioVideoPlayBack


Mx
MVP C#
 


mercredi 8 mars 2006 à 13:52:28 | Re : Lire un fichier son au chargement d'une form

Tupac59

C'est pas très clair aussi dans les liens que tu m'as donné. Dommage on peut pas faire : insérer un son dans la form un truc comme ca lol.

Je ne sais pas en quel .NET je suis je vais essayer de me débrouiller sinon je redemanderai un coup de main merci quand meme pour ton aide

mercredi 8 mars 2006 à 13:55:21 | Re : Lire un fichier son au chargement d'une form

MorpionMx

Membre Club Administrateur CodeS-SourceS
Tu peux savoir en quelle version de .net tu utilises selon ce que tu utilises comme IDE ;)

Mx
MVP C#
 


mercredi 8 mars 2006 à 16:04:54 | Re : Lire un fichier son au chargement d'une form

Tupac59

lol je sais meme pas ce que c'est ca l'IDE

mercredi 8 mars 2006 à 16:06:38 | Re : Lire un fichier son au chargement d'une form

MorpionMx

Membre Club Administrateur CodeS-SourceS
Ton environnement de developpement.
Visual Studio .Net, 2003, 2005, SharpDevelop, ... ?

Mx
MVP C#
 


mercredi 8 mars 2006 à 16:13:24 | Re : Lire un fichier son au chargement d'une form
mercredi 8 mars 2006 à 16:22:39 | Re : Lire un fichier son au chargement d'une form

MorpionMx

Membre Club Administrateur CodeS-SourceS
Alors c'est du .net 1
En fait, il n'y a aucune classe qui permette de jouer du son dans le framework .net 1
Il faut utiliser une API windows, ce qui rend la chose un peu plus compliquée (mais pas trop)

En pas a pas, voila ce qu'il faut faire
Declarer l'espace de nom qui va bien en haut de ta classe:


using System.Runtime.InteropServices;


ensuite, il te faut declarer la méthode de l'API windows pour pouvoir l'utiliser


[DllImport("winmm.dll")]
private static extern bool PlaySound( string lpszName, int hModule, int dwFlags );



Et finalement, pour jouer ton son, tu auras juste a faire :

PlaySound( cheminDeTonFichier, 0, 1 );



Mx
MVP C#
 


jeudi 9 mars 2006 à 19:40:46 | Re : Lire un fichier son au chargement d'une form

Tupac59

Je te remercie beaucoup Morpion mais j'ai encore 1 petit problème lol je sais que je suis chiant. Si par exemple je met chimes.wav ca fonctionne mais si je met une chanson que j'ai convertir en wav, il ne se passe rien

Quel est le problème ?

jeudi 9 mars 2006 à 19:44:31 | Re : Lire un fichier son au chargement d'une form

MorpionMx

Membre Club Administrateur CodeS-SourceS
Tu indiques bien le bon chemin pour ton fichier son ?

Mx
MVP C#
 



1 2

Cette discussion est classé dans : fichier, form, lire, chargement


Répondre à ce message

Sujets en rapport avec ce message

Ecrire et lire des enregistrements... [ par LRRP ] Comment faire pour ecrire dans un fichier des enregistrements que l'on a défini (par exemple une personne avec son nom, prenom, tel ...etc).Puis lire lecture de fichier ... [ par maevacmoi ] Hello !Je voudrais lire, depuis un site web (C#) , un fichier xml (monfichier.xml) qui se trouve sur le disque local. J'ai fait pas mal de tests, mais Lire les Tags ID3V2 d'un fichier MP3 [ par jesusonline ] Bonjour j'aimerais lire les tags des fichiers ID3V2 mais je ne connais rien à ce format.J'ai trouvé une classe en C++ qui permet de lire les Tags ID3V lire et ecrire dans un fichier au secours [ par liliemumue ] Au secours c urgent Je ne sais pas comment faire !! J'ai une variable : un entier 0000 Que je voudrais sauvegarder dans un fichier. Si le chier n'esxi [Appli Windows][c#] Lire des infos dans un fichier texte (txt) formaté puis les traités et les exporté sur mysql [ par Julos59 ] Bonjour voila j'ai une question multiple qui se complique au fur rt a mesure :-)Je débute en c# donc ma première partie de question est simple.J'ai un Problème de console au chargement de la form [ par Jujufouq ] Bonjour à tous!Je ne sais pas si ce problème a déjà été posté, mais j'ai ce problème. Voici mon code :using System;using System.Windows.Forms;class fr Ecrire et lire dans un fichier [ par streetlife ] Bonjour.Voila, j'enregistre dans un fichier plusieurs structures et, en lecture, je souhaiterais lire un seul chanps afin de faire une vérification ma Lire un Control d'une autre Form? [ par TheGregg ] Salut,j'ai un petit probleme, je dois lire le texte d'un label qui est sur une autre form ...j'utilise 1 fichier pour chaque form et je vois pas trop lire un fichier binaire [ par ultrafil ] Salut, j'ai besoin de lire des données dans un fichier binaire.Mon problème c'est que je n'arrive pas à faire de conversion en byte[]Je m'explique, j' lire ds un fichier a une ligne donnée [ par raziel62 ] SALUT,comment on fait en C# (pas c++) pour lire et écrire dans un fichier texte à une ligne donnée svp?MERCIje voudrai les principales commandes, comm


Nos sponsors

Sondage...

CalendriCode

Novembre 2008
LMMJVSD
     12
3456789
10111213141516
17181920212223
24252627282930

Consulter la suite du CalendriCode

Téléchargements

Logiciels à télécharger sur le même thème :



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el BAÏSE, Merci à Vincent pour ses précieux conseils
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és
Temps d'éxécution de la page : 0,156 sec

Google Coop CodeS-SourceS Google Coop CodeS-SourceS


Certaines images présentes sur le site (notament certains avatars) sont issues des collections IconShock, donc si vous souhaitez utiliser ces icons vous devez les acheter, ne les copiez pas et ne utilisez pas dans vos sites et applications sans les avoir commandé.